When you use the z/OSMF Deployment action to install a ServerPac, you're 
telling z/OSMF you want to install the software provided in that 
ServerPac.  To "install software" means z/OSMF will create data sets. 
Therefore, before it attempts to create any data sets, it ensures there 
are no unintended collisions with existing data sets on your specified 
volumes and in the catalogs.  You either have to modify the data set names 
in the configuration, or rename or delete the existing data sets so there 
are no unintended collisions.

If you want z/OSMF to consider such collisions to be intended, then tell 
z/OSMF to delete the existing data sets.  You do this either by selecting 
a software instance to be replaced that contains the subject data sets, or 
by indicating the target volume that contains the subject data sets will 
be initialized.  Both options result in z/OSMF considering such collisions 
to be intended, and the existing data sets will get deleted explicitly.

What "migration action XML" are you talking about?  The customization 
workflows supplied in the ServerPac?  If so, those workflows are not 
designed to be performed stand alone.  They are designed to be performed 
from Software Management when you install the ServerPac PSWI.
